When a cheque is issued by a business, it is recorded in the credit side of the cash book (because cash or bank balance is reducing). However, if the recipient has not yet presented the cheque to the bank for payment, it won't appear on the bank statement.
Such a cheque is known as an unpresented cheque - it has been recorded by the business but not yet cleared by the bank.
